Optimizing Cold Storage Structures with Pre-Engineered Steel

Modern distribution centers increasingly necessitate efficient frozen solutions. Pre-engineered metal buildings present a compelling alternative for constructing these critical facilities . They allow for rapid construction, reducing completion dates and budgets. The inherent resilience of steel guarantees the structural stability needed to resist the low temperatures common in refrigerated environments. Moreover, pre-engineered solutions allow for tailoring to specific needs , incorporating features such as temperature-controlled doors. Consider these pluses:

Designing Durable Cold Storage with H-Beam Integration

In realize dependable cold storage , employing H-beam construction offers crucial advantages . These design methodology enables for increased load-bearing capacity , particularly necessary dealing with low temperatures and significant snow loads . Additionally, H-beams provide excellent defense against lateral stresses, assisting in full equilibrium within the building .
